Ukraine's USD 1 bln Eurobond Issue Pushes 2006 Currency Reserves To New High

10 January 2008

According to the National Bank, Ukraine’s gold foreign currency reserves grew by 14.9% yoy in 2006 to a new historical high of USD 22.3 bln, up from USD 19.4 in 2005. The main reason for this year’s growth was the government’s USD 1 bln Eurobond placement.
